Facts about Dual specificity mitogen-activated protein kinase kinase 4.
With MAP2K7/MKK7, is the one of the only known kinase to directly activate the stress-activated protein kinase/c-Jun N-terminal kinases MAPK8/JNK1, MAPK9/JNK2 and MAPK10/JNK3. MAP2K4/MKK4 and MAP2K7/MKK7 both activate the JNKs by phosphorylation, but they differ in their taste for the phosphorylation site in the Thr-Pro-Tyr motif.

Abundant expression is seen in the skeletal muscle. It is also widely expressed in other tissues.
Cytoplasm. Nucleus.
